Обсуждение:Частичная реализация инструкции 113-И в RS-Retail: единый реестр
0 (0)
Обсуждение:Частичная реализация инструкции 113-И в RS-Retail: единый реестр ( Обсуждение примера 18.06.2004 15:24 )
0(0)Ограничения:
- При проведении каждой операции необходимо в форме ввода операции заполнять графу «N ордера».
- Данные в реестре полностью заполняются только для операций покупки/продажи валюты (код операций 01, 02, 03). По остальным операциям данные вводятся вручную в режиме редактирования.
- Корректно работает, если курс меняется раз в день, т.к. все операции попадают в один реестр.
- В реестр не попадают операции по валютным вкладам.
Для установки достаточно скопировать макрос в каталог ..\mac и сделать пункт меню пользователю.
Макрос разрабатывался по ТЗ "Постановка на реализацию единого реестра в ОП (временно).doc" (также содержится в прикрепленном архиве).
Автор макроса: Юрий Чахмахчев
Посмотреть пример
>> Ответитьругается "невозможно открыть файл trlocale.d32" ( S_Andrey 18.06.2004 15:29 )
0(0)пробовал ложить его везде...
>> Ответитьпечать в Excel ( Волкова Елена 18.06.2004 15:42 )
0(0)Спасибо, что сообщили, это связано с печатью в Excel... все необходимые файлы я выложила, скачайте пример еще раз.
>> Ответитьвсеравно таже ошибка в mac\_rs_rep\or_rep_h.mac ( S_Andrey 18.06.2004 16:22 )
0(0)невозможно открыть файл trlocale.d32
>> ОтветитьА вы прописали пути в MACRODIR? и какая сборка Retail у Вас? (+) ( Волкова Елена 18.06.2004 16:34 )
0(0)Я только что проверила - всё работает на 9327. Если у Вас 83-я сборка, то работать, естественно, ничего не будет.
>> ОтветитьНа 9326, надо полагать, тоже не будет? Ибо не работает (+) ( petrocom 18.06.2004 17:13 )
0(0)Из-за различия в ключе 0.
>> Ответитьна 9326 макрос тоже работает ( Волкова Елена 21.06.2004 13:31 )
0(0)Я посмотрела ключи для exoperat.dbt - и в 9326, и в 9327 ключ "0" одинаковы. Кроме того, в макросе была ошибка - на самом деле там нужно использовать ключ "4", эти ключи на 9326 и 9327 также одинаковы.
>> Ответить
еще можете попробовать отключить печать в Excel... ( Волкова Елена 18.06.2004 16:36 )
0(0)все сделал. и пути полные прописывал... ( S_Andrey 18.06.2004 17:01 )
0(0)retail 5.10.93.25
>> Ответитьпроверьте Macrodir ( Волкова Елена 18.06.2004 17:13 )
0(0)Проверьте, может быть у Вас есть одноименный файл, но более старый, а в MACRODIR пути прописаны так, что система сначала находит старый файл и не может с ним работать?
>> Ответитьположите trlocale.d32 в Obj ( Волкова Елена 18.06.2004 17:15 )
0(0)Появилась еще одна идея - положите этот файл в Obj.
>> Ответитьи еще уточните, пожалуйста, в двух- или трехзвенке Вы запускаете этот макрос? ( Волкова Елена 18.06.2004 17:22 )
0(0)В трехзвенке нужно делать дополнительные настройки, а кроме того, мы тестировали работу макросов только в трехзвенке.
>> Ответить
Еще одна реализация реестра 113 И для 83 сборки ритейла ( Demaio 18.06.2004 17:47 )
0(0)Еще одна реализация реестра 113 И для 83 сборки ритейла
http://support.softlab.ru/Portal/Samples/sample.asp?Typ=11&Id=218
>> Ответитьгде можно получить полную реализацию инструкции 113-и в RS-Retail. ( omm 27.09.2004 11:00 )
0(0)Retail 5.1.093.30.. Запускаю реестр (почему-то из пункта ВОО, хотя реестр относится ко всем операциям с наличной валютой). В результате получаю пустой файл формата rstr113i.xls. Из недоразумений - по ходу работы программы выдается сообщение на красном фоне "Msgbox Mac\or_exl_h.mac". При формировании формы 601 сообщение точно такое-же, но отчет все-же формируется.
>> ОтветитьПолная реализация есть в дистрибутиве ( Волкова Елена 27.09.2004 11:22 )
0(0)Использовать временное решение с частичной реализацией в RS-Retail нет необходимости, начиная с патча 5.1.093.28, вся функциональность, связанная с 113-И уже входит в дистрибутив. Если вы используете штатные макросы, а не макросы, предложенные в качестве временного решения, то реестр должен сформироваться. Если он не сформировался - то, значит, что скорее всего что-то недонастроено (например, есть условие, что в реестр будут попадать только те операции, по которым сформировалась справка, регламентируемая 113-И), в этом случае рекомендуем открыть тему в I-поддержке, или обратиться на горячую линию, поскольку этот вопрос уже технический и может быть решен в рамках консультаций.
>> Ответить